This is probably going to be controversial. But how about the attached simple 
patch to just have ./db exist, and then have Cassandra configured to use that 
by default? This makes it a lot easier for people to just run Cassandra out of 
the working copy, whether you are a developer or a user who wants to apply a 
patch when being assisted by a Cassandra developer.

A real deployment with packaging should properly override these paths anyway, 
and the default /var/lib stuff is pretty useless. Even if you are root on the 
machine, who it is much cleaner to just run self-contained.

Yes, I am aware that you can over-ride the configuration but honestly, that's 
just painful. Especially when switching between various versions of Cassandra.
